Page from The Illustrated London News featuring photographs of a modernist building in Turin, a Fiat car factory with a motor track on the roof. The track was built roughly in the shape of an ancient Roman chariot-racing arena, and was used for testing and running-in the products of the works, without the necessity for new cars to leave the factory for tests on public roads. The factory closed in 1982 and was re-built as a public space called the Lingotto Building.
